We’re looking for a proactive Multi-Skilled Maintenance Engineer to join our Engineering team at our Fells site in Lennoxtown.

This is a hands-on role where you’ll help keep our production lines running safely and efficiently. You’ll support planned maintenance, respond to breakdowns, carry out fault finding and contribute to improvement activity across the site. Working closely with Engineering and Operations colleagues, you’ll play an important part in improving equipment reliability, reducing downtime and maintaining high standards of safety, quality and performance.

The role follows a rotational 3-week day and night shift pattern, working 07:45–20:00 / 19:45–08:00. This includes 2 weeks of dayshift, working 7 shifts over 14 days, followed by 1 week of nightshift on a 4-on, 3-off basis.

What you’ll do

  • Carry out planned preventative maintenance and reactive maintenance across production equipment.
  • Diagnose faults and take effective corrective action to reduce downtime.
  • Support production teams to improve equipment performance, line efficiency and reliability.
  • Contribute to continuous improvement and engineering improvement projects.
  • Work safely and follow site procedures, risk assessments and safe systems of work.
  • Help maintain high standards of GMP, food safety, product quality and workshop compliance.
  • Support other Highland Spring Group sites when required.

What we’re looking for

  • A time-served engineer with strong mechanical maintenance experience.
  • Good fault-finding and problem-solving skills.
  • Experience in a manufacturing, FMCG, food or drink production environment would be beneficial.
  • A practical, organised approach with the ability to prioritise your workload.
  • Someone who can work confidently on their own initiative and as part of a team.
  • Basic IT skills, including email, Word and Excel.
  • A full UK driving licence.

At Highland Spring Group, our values — We’re a Team, We’re Proud and We Care — guide how we work together every day. We’re looking for someone who takes pride in their work, supports others, works safely and wants to make a positive difference.

The annual salary for this role is £51,769.97, which is inclusive of shift allowance

If you’re a motivated maintenance engineer who enjoys solving problems, improving performance and being part of a supportive team, we’d love to hear from you.
